When I'm forced to install any version of Windows on a system for anyone I 
always include a copy of the utility Neil Rubenking of PC Magazine wrote 
because of this problem. It's called "Startup Cop" and you can use it to make 
"profiles" that allow you to switch from (for instance) "work" and "play." 

Why use it? Simple. You may not want to permanently stop anti-virus, firewall, 
time synchronisation, instant messenger, etc apps from running in the 
background. Other times (if you have an always on high speed connection for 
example) you may not even want to be connected to the 'net while you run a 
game or video that firewalls or AV programs will crash. Right? That would 
probably mean a "work" profile would include these but "play" (gaming, 
watching videos and so on) wouldn't. Profiles, remember?

I used the program when I ran Windows 'cause I was to lazy to do the 
"msconfig" thing every time I wanted to do something that required more 
resources than Windows default boot left available. Three clicks (to switch 
profiles) was preferable to typing and reading a list and having to fight 
Windows for control.
